--- Quote from: MLHSN on October 20, 2025, 06:35:51 AM ---Trying to expand my knowledge past spring morels I was wondering if these could be matsutake, but I don't see a veil? --- End quote --- The easiest way to tell if it’s matsutakes is the smell. They have a spicy smell to them that is like nothing else. When they get old the veil peels back. Also brown on the stem. However when in doubt throw it out |
| pianoman9701:
Another matsutake characteristic is that the butt will almost always have sand on it and there's no bulb. The butt goes down to a dull point. I see no matsutake in any of these pics. |
